Since the 21st century, educational informationization has become an important strategy to promote the education reform in many countries, and the new curriculum reform in our country makes new demands on the application of information technology in mathematics classroom. Under the background of educational informationization, based on video analyses with quantitative and qualitative methods, this research would analyze the situation of the application of information technology in junior mathematics classroom in the two countries, with the consideration of trends in international mathematics researches and mathematics curriculum reform in China, and we would analyze the origin of this situation and provide practical suggestions. The results of the research would provide important evidences for the integration of information technology and curriculum in basic education in China.The first chapter of this thesis presents the background, significance and methods of the research, and also reviews the previous researches at home and abroad. The second chapter summarizes their common concerns on the classroom teaching by comparing and analyzing the main policies of educational informatization of China and America. The third chapter describes the samples and framework of the video study. In the fourth chapter, the author analyzed the data of the video analysis obtained at first, then did a typical case study to find more details, and then made a comparative analysis of the possible causes of the present situation of the two countries reflected by the study, mainly through the analysis of the policies and the international assessment reports that described in the previous chapters. The fifth chapter puts forward feasible suggestions and the future direction, on the basis of summarizing research results.The study shows that:There're many similarities and dissimilarities of the use of ICT in junior mathematics classroom between the two countries. The policies has made a certain influence on classroom teaching, especially in the creation of ICT-supported learning environment and the improvement of teachers and students'information literacy, but there is a long way to go for better application of information technology in mathematics classroom, like using ICT to better support teaching, learning and assessment.
